將大型、多 TB 的 MySQL 或 MariaDB 資料庫遷移到AWS - AWS 規定指引

本文為英文版的機器翻譯版本,如內容有任何歧義或不一致之處,概以英文版為準。

將大型、多 TB 的 MySQL 或 MariaDB 資料庫遷移到AWS

巴比亞·瓦盧魯和安庫爾·巴哈納瓦特,亞馬遜 Web 服務(AWS)

2023 年八月(文件歷史)

許多擁有內部部署 MySQL 和 MariaDB 資料庫伺服器的組織都有興趣將其資料庫工作負載移轉至AWS 雲端。許多人選擇亞馬遜關聯式資料庫服務 (亞馬遜 RDS),適用於 MySQL 的亞馬遜 RDS 或亞馬遜極光 MySQL 兼容版本。亞馬遜 RDS旨在讓您在雲端中輕鬆設定、操作和擴展關聯式資料庫。亞馬遜極光屬於 Amazon RDS,提供內建安全性、持續備份、無伺服器運算、最多 15 個僅供讀取複本、自動化多區域複寫,以及與其他伺服器整合AWS 服務。

雖然遷移到其中之一AWS 服務可提供許多好處,資料庫移轉是資料庫管理員必須執行的最耗時且最重要的工作之一。它需要精確的規劃和實作,才能移轉大型資料庫,並確保移轉工作負載的效能相等或改善。在本指南中,資料庫可以參考單一、多 TB 的資料庫,或參考許多大型資料庫,這些資料庫加起來最多可達數 TB 的資料。選擇正確的遷移服務和工具是遷移成功的關鍵。遷移資料庫有兩種常見的方法:邏輯和實體。如需這些方法的詳細資訊,請參閱MySQL玛丽亚德文件。

本指南討論各種開放原始碼或第三方工具,您可以使用這些工具將大型的內部部署多 TB MySQL 和 MariaDB 資料庫遷移到 Amazon RDS (適用於 MariaDB)、Amazon RDS for MySQL 或亞馬遜極光 MySQL 相容版本。本指南中討論的選項使用邏輯或實體移轉方法,每個選項都包含多種方法,可將大型資料庫備份檔案從內部部署資料中心傳輸到雲端,您可以從備份檔案還原資料庫。

目標對象

本指南適用於計劃將 MySQL 或 MariaDB 資料庫移轉至AWS 雲端。

目標業務成果

本指南的目標是幫助您:

  • 選擇最適合您使用案例和環境的大型資料庫的移轉方法。

  • 避免遷移策略有缺陷時可能發生的延誤和財務損失。

  • 瞭解每個移轉選項的優點和限制。

  • 瞭解可用來將大型資料庫備份檔案從內部部署資料中心傳輸到AWS 雲端。

  • 檢閱移轉大型資料庫的整體最佳作法,並檢閱每個工具的最佳作法,以協助您更有效率地移轉資料庫。